Been using Hy-Slicer a fair bit recently:
hy-slice.jpg
What I really like are the various waveforms available at each step which really mangle the sound, making sliced loops sound more like synth drums... which got me thinking...

Are there any drum synth VSTs with a similar layout/function to Hy-Slice, especially the selectable multi-waveforms?

I'm sure there are, but not having used many drum synth VSTs before a brief trawl around search engines has been less than fruitful since I find myself digging thru tons of VSTs that are aimed at sounding like real drums... which is not what I'm looking for at all.

Sugar Bytes Drum Computer looks like it might fit the bill, but other than that, I'd appreciate any recommendations folks have.

Happy to report that Sugar Bytes Drum Computer is just about everything I was hoping for... and then some!

Great sounds, not pretending to be anything other than synthetic (although you can switch between wavetable and analogue), extensively manipulable in a really musical way... good sequencing capability as well as multi-out routing. Doesn't quite have the ability to import a groove from an existing MIDI file, but individual beats can be "offset" as required and the humanize function is very cool as it refreshes itself every two bars or so.

Really can't fault it, brilliant VST :)
